Technological Advancements in Communication

In the field of communication, new technology has revolutionized the way we interact with one another. Smartphones, with their limitless connectivity and convenience, have become an inseparable part of our lives. Our relationships are no longer confined to physical proximity, as we can connect with loved ones across the globe with just a few taps on a screen. However, the rise of smartphones has also brought about some negative implications. Face-to-face interactions have taken a hit, as people increasingly rely on digital communication, leading to a potential decline in social skills and mental health issues.

Another aspect of communication greatly impacted by new technology is social media.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ter have connected people from different corners of the world, fostering global networking and information sharing. We have never been more connected, to the point where social media has become an integral part of our personal and professional lives. However, the rise of cyberbullying and privacy concerns are some of the downsides accompanying this interconnectedness. It is essential to strike a balance between embracing the benefits of technological communication and being mindful of its potential drawbacks.

Influence on Education and Learning

The digital era has brought forth significant transformations in the field of education. Online education platforms have played a pivotal role in increasing accessibility and affordability of education. Anyone with an internet connection can now access quality educational resources and courses, breaking down barriers like geographical constraints. However, the digital divide remains a challenge, as access to technology and reliable internet is still unevenly distributed, particularly in rural and low-income areas. Additionally, virtual learning fatigue and the lack of face-to-face interactions pose unique challenges for both students and educators.

Integrating technology in classrooms has become increasingly common, with interactive screens and tablets replacing traditional blackboards. Technology allows for personalized learning experiences, catering to individual students’ needs and enhancing their engagement. However, finding the right balance between screen time and the development of critical thinking skills is a crucial consideration. Technology is a powerful tool to aid education, but it should not supplant the value of human interaction and diverse learning experiences.

Enhancements in Healthcare and Medicine

New technology has also made significant strides in the healthcare and medical sectors. Artificial intelligence, for instance, has played a crucial role in improving diagnostics and treatment. With AI algorithms, medical professionals can analyze vast amounts of data with greater accuracy and efficiency. This results in more precise and timely diagnoses, potentially saving lives. However, ethical concerns arise, as the advancement of AI may lead to job displacement and questions regarding the responsibility and transparency of AI-powered decision-making in healthcare.

Wearable technology is another facet of new technology that has affected human lives, particularly in personal health management. Devices like fitness trackers and smartwatches allow us to monitor vital parameters such as heart rate, steps taken, and sleep patterns. This data empowers individuals to make informed decisions about their lifestyle and well-being. By integrating technology and health, we have the opportunity to proactively manage our health and prevent the onset of certain illnesses. However, it is crucial to remember that these devices are tools and should not replace professional medical advice when needed.

Economic and Social Disruptions

The advancement of new technology has also garnered attention in the economic and social spheres. Automation has redefined the future of work, with the potential of job displacement and shifts in required skill sets. While machines take over certain tasks, new job opportunities arise in emerging fields that require a high degree of technological literacy. It is crucial for individuals to adapt and acquire the necessary skills to thrive in this rapidly evolving landscape.

However, the impact of new technology on the economy goes beyond the job market. Income inequality and the digital divide are intertwined, as uneven access to technology further widens socioeconomic disparities. Bridging the digital divide and promoting inclusivity and equal access to technology are essential in ensuring that the benefits of new technology are not concentrated in the hands of a few.

Ethical Considerations in the Technological Age

While new technology has undoubtedly brought many benefits, ethics must play a central role in guiding its development and use. Artificial intelligence, in particular, raises significant privacy concerns. Data breaches and unauthorized access to personal information are ever-present risks in a data-driven world. Robust privacy regulations and responsible technology use are vital in preserving individuals’ rights and trust in technology.

Moreover, emerging technologies pose various ethical dilemmas. For instance, gene editing technologies like CRISPR-Cas9 raise questions about the boundaries of scientific intervention and the long-term implications of altering the human genome. Similarly, the development of autonomous vehicles presents ethical challenges surrounding safety, decision-making algorithms, and liability in case of accidents. Establishing ethical frameworks and guidelines that encompass various technological advancements is imperative to navigate the ethical complexities of the technological age.
